Tennis Update from Monday, April 15; Cashmere @ Chelan

The odd Monday timing of this match is due to the fact this is a rainout make-up from late March.  It was NOT a great day for tennis.  The wind made play very difficult.

Girls:  Cashmere 4, Chelan 1

#1 Singles:  Faith Kert (Cash) def Maya Cowan 6-0, 6-2
#2 Singles:  Freya Dronen (Cash) def Ellie McLemore 6-1, 6-4
#3 Singles:  Josie Garfoot (Ch) def Hazel Schade 6-1, 6-2
#1 Doubles:  Reese Westlund/Lucy Ray (Cash) def Estee Flynn/Brooklyn Foyle 6-2, 6-3
#2 Doubles:  Layne Varrelman/Hadley Westlund (Cash) def Alison Horner/Madeline Cowan 6-3, 6-4
We saw tonight why the Cashmere girls remain undefeated: talented at the top and good depth.  I was pleased with how our Chelan girls competed.  Nothing was easy.

Boys:  Chelan 4, Cashmere 1

#1 Singles:  Albin Eskew (Cash) def Rylen Moody 3-6, 7-6(7-3), 6-1
#2 Singles:  Ian Garfoot (Ch) def Reed Lewis 6-2, 6-2
#3 Singles:  Cray Silva (Ch) def Tony Bumgarner 6-0, 6-1
#1 Doubles:  Wade & Caleb Sanderson (Ch) def Josh Dotson/Seth Martin 6-4, 6-2
#2 Doubles:  George Neff/Elijah Moody (Ch) def Kyle Weedman/Jackson Meloy 6-1, 6-3
The Chelan boys improve to 4-1 in the CTL and 6-2 overall.
